AMD Ryzen 7 5700G vs Intel Core i3 12100

We compared two desktop CPUs: AMD Ryzen 7 5700G with 8 cores 3.8GHz and Intel Core i3 12100 with 4 cores 3.3G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D Ryzen 7 5700G 's Advantages
Higher base frequency (3.8GHz vs 3.3GHz)
Larger L3 cache size (16MB vs 12MB)
Lower TDP (45W vs 60W)
Intel Core i3 12100 's Advantages
Released 9 months late
Higher specification of memory (DDR5-4800 vs DDR4-3200)
Larger memory bandwidth (76.8GB/s vs 51.2GB/s)
Newer PCIe version (5.0 vs 3.0)
